Slain officer hailed as hero


THE New York police officer killed in a mass shooting in a Manhattan skyscraper was an immigrant who left behind a pregnant wife, two young sons and distraught parents, while friends and officials in Bangladesh and the United States described him as a hero.

A gunman opened fire on Monday inside a midtown office tower, killing four people, including Officer Didarul Islam (pic), 36, before fatally shooting himself, officials said.
